Output 03c58c41c287b22ea3b1ca519d5cea0cb35f36200e00eab4b5935affe77b6e16: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3dd62c84e79d326db36e0d019012e13b9fd6af OP_EQUAL
address
9zfRZ8xGePfmeEz9NPB8419McvjWZ4puHm
transaction
03c58c41c287b22ea3b1ca519d5cea0cb35f36200e00eab4b5935affe77b6e16